How does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A work?
The key to Deep Tissue Bio-Remodelling HA is its ability to regenerate the fat pads that gradually shrink and deflate with age. By restoring these natural support structures, the face regains its youthful contours and definition, enhancing the “V-shape” without adding artificial bulk. This is possible through a patented hyaluronic acid complex (90 mg/2 ml), placed in the deeper tissue layers where it also stimulates collagen and elastin, strengthens the skin’s framework, and improves hydration. The result is a firmer, more resilient foundation that looks natural, not overfilled.
Is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A a Skinbooster or a Filler?
It is neither.
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A is a patented form of stabilised hyaluronic acid designed for a regenerative approach. Unlike skinboosters that target the superficial layers or fillers that are placed deeper for volumising,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A works in between. It replenishes fat pads that naturally deflate with age, reduces sagging, and improves hollowed, tired areas. Additionally, it stimulates collagen and elastin production and provides gentle hydration, leaving the face looking naturally refreshed and subtly lifted.
Is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A right for me?
This treatment is suited for both men and women, typically in their 40s and 50s, who experience mild to moderate skin laxity, loss of facial contour, or early hollowing of the cheeks. By regenerating facial fat pads and stimulating collagen and elastin, it helps restore definition, soften lines, and firm the skin — all with minimal injection points for comfort.
It can also serve as a preventative option for patients in their 30s who wish to maintain skin quality and delay the onset of laxity, and remains beneficial into the 60s for those seeking subtle yet meaningful support. Because it hydrates while strengthening the skin’s foundation, the treatment is suitable for all skin types and is associated with little to no downtime.
How many sessions will I need?
The initial treatment protocol consists of 2 treatments spaced 1 month apart, with a maintenance treatment every 6 months or as needed.
What can I expect during and after the procedure?
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A is administered using a fine microcannula through 1 small entry point on each side of the face. The treatment takes 10 minutes, with topical and local anaesthesia for comfort.
The session concludes with LED light therapy to calm the skin and speed recovery. Mild swelling or bruising at the entry sites may occur but usually subsides within a few days.
Can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A be combined with other treatments?
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A can be combined with energy-based lifting treatments such as Microfocused Ultrasound with Visualisation (MFU), High-Intensity Focused Ultrasound (HIFU), and Radiofrequency (RF Lift) to achieve a more visible, longer-lasting lift.
Who is not a good candidate for Deep Tissue Bio-remodelling HA?
Women who are breastfeeding or pregnant should not receive bio-remodelling HA treatments.
What do I prepare for Bio-remodelling HA?
To minimise bruising, stop blood-thinning supplements and medications 5 days before your treatment. This includes aspirin, vitamin E, fish oil and ginkgo.
